Results of an 8 hour slowdown
Gov't caves in once again! They want inflation to run rampant:
"En el primer aumento, que se espera que rija a partir de la semana próxima, la ficha que cae cada 200 metros recorridos o por cada minuto de espera pasará de 22 a 24 centavos why la bajada de bandera subirá de 1,98 peso a 2,16." (from The Clarin)
So it's 2.16 to start and 24 cents per minute or 200 meters. Another increase coming in Nov. Or Dec. As follows: (another 9% or so)
"Además se convocará para setiembre u octubre a una audiencia pública para discutir un segundo aumento que se concretaría en noviembre o diciembre. En esa oportunidad —según lo acordado— la ficha pasará a 26 centavos, pero la bajada de bandera aumentará más, porque irá de las 9 fichas que se cobran hoy a 10. Así, cuando una persona comience un viaje, el taxímetro marcará 2,60 pesos." (from the Clarin)
I hope the girls don't figure out this system of strike for a day and get immediate increases. It has worked for truckers, subway workers, oil workers, airline workers, etc. There is very little fiscal discipline here.
